Bug#291246: gcc-3.4: internal compiler error: Didn't find a coloring.

2005-01-19 Thread Emmanuel Fleury
Package: gcc-3.4
Version: 3.4.3-7
Severity: important
Hi,
I'm using the acovea software to try out some compiling optimization and 
I found these bug:

/etc/acovea/benchmarks/treebench.c: In function `btree_remove':
/etc/acovea/benchmarks/treebench.c:996: internal compiler error: Didn't 
find a coloring.

Please submit a full bug report,
with preprocessed source if appropriate.
See http://gcc.gnu.org/bugs.html> for instructions.
For Debian GNU/Linux specific bug reporting instructions,
see .
COMPILE FAILED:
gcc-3.4 -lrt -lm -std=gnu99 -O1 -march=pentium3 -o ACOVEA5F53B52F 
-fno-defer-pop -fno-omit-frame-pointer -fcse-follow-jumps -fgcse 
-fexpensive-optimizations -frerun-cse-after-loop -fcaller-saves 
-fforce-mem -fpeephole2 -fschedule-insns -fschedule-insns2 -fregmove 
-fstrict-aliasing -freorder-blocks -fsched-interblock -fsched-spec 
-freorder-functions -falign-jumps -falign-labels -freduce-all-givs 
-fno-inline -ftracer -fnew-ra -mieee-fp -malign-double -mno-push-args 
-mno-align-stringops -mfpmath=387 -momit-leaf-frame-pointer 
-fno-math-errno -funsafe-math-optimizations -fno-signaling-nans 
-finline-limit=700 /etc/acovea/benchmarks/treebench.c

I reproduced the bug on two differents architectures (TM5800 and i686).
